ebooks, industry reports, blogs, and on-demand webinars to help you learn the basics. Cluster"},{"title":"NoSQL Database","subItems":[{"title":"ApsaraDB for 简体中文","key":"zh"}],"followUsLinks":[{"icon":"fa fa-facebook" 

7941

That's why Facebook developed Cassandra. NoSQL basically means you make do without some SQL-typical features like immediate consistency or easy joins, in exchange for being able to use a database that scales much better.

In a relational database, you are required to define your schema before adding data to the database. The term NoSQL refers to data stores that do not use SQL for queries, and instead use other programming languages and constructs to query the data. In practice, "NoSQL" means "non-relational database," even though many of these databases do support SQL-compatible queries. Se hela listan på hub.packtpub.com 2011-01-02 · Twitter is still experimenting with its use of Cassandra, an open-source NoSQL database created by Facebook.

Does facebook use nosql

  1. Boomerang solutions jobb
  2. Bramserud citat
  3. Karlskrona torg

Let us know in the comments. NoSQL is a non-relational DMS, that does not require a fixed schema, avoids joins, and is easy to scale; The concept of NoSQL databases beccame popular with Internet giants like Google, Facebook, Amazon, etc. who deal with huge volumes of data; In the year 1998- Carlo Strozzi use the term NoSQL for his lightweight, open-source relational database Consider just a few examples of global businesses that are deploying NoSQL for their applications. From Twitter, Facebook, and Google, to Tesco, Ryanair, Marriott, Gannett, and other big and small enterprises, which accumulate Terabits of data every single day and use NoSQL for their Big data and real-time web apps. Ways to use NoSQL database systems. Using data models based on NoSQL are a great fit for companies that want to build mobile, web, Internet of Things (IoT), and gaming apps that require flexible, scalable, high-performance, and highly functional databases to provide great user experiences—whether it’s gaming, e-commerce, big data analytics NoSQL Databases.

NoSQL databases feature dynamic schema, and allow you to use what’s known as “unstructured data.” This means you can build your application without having to first define the schema.

In these cases use NoSQL databases, you will get much more flexibility than its traditional counterparts. Let’s discuss 5 important features of NoSQL databases. It will give you a clear picture when to use it… 1. Multi-Model. Relational databases store data in a fixed and predefined structure. It means when you start development you will

Of the well known public NoSQL solutions: HBase is used for messages and monitoring Hadoop /hive is the primary big data analytical store In early 2009, FB started building TAO, a FB-specific NoSQL graph API built to run on sharded MySQL. The goal was to solve the problems highlighted in the previous section. TAO stands for “The MySQL is the primary database used by Facebook for storing all the social data. It started with the InnoDB MySQL database engine & then wrote MyRocksDB, which was eventually used as the MySQL Database engine.

Does facebook use nosql

Are you a developer that has worked with cloud? Where you implemented solutions using containers or serverless technologies. Is your passion building Serverless technologies; Databases from nosql to relational databases (postgres, mysql, ms sql). How do you Facebook · Twitter · Instagram · Linkedin · WhatsApp.

NoSQL systems are also sometimes called "Not only SQL" to emphasize that they may 189.

Does facebook use nosql

being two big names making use of the technology. 4 Aug 2014 Today, there are too many NoSQL databases to keep track of. And when Facebook decided to use Hbase instead of Cassandra for its messaging  9 Mar 2017 Reasons to Use a SQL Database. Not every database fits every business need. That's why many companies rely on both relational and non-  Today most of the famous companies such as Facebook, Google, Amazon, Yahoo etc.
Gymnasium inriktning kriminologi

Does facebook use nosql

Shorthand for insert/update is save - if _id value set, the record is updated if it exists or inserted if it does not; if the _id value is not set, then the record is inserted  In doing so, it forced its developers to completely give up on SQL as a flexible query API and adopt TAO’s custom NoSQL API. Most of us in the enterprise world do not have Facebook-scale problems but nevertheless want to scale out SQL databases on-demand. There are a variety of NoSQL data stores in use at Facebook. Of the well known public NoSQL solutions: HBase is used for messages and monitoring Hadoop /hive is the primary big data analytical store In early 2009, FB started building TAO, a FB-specific NoSQL graph API built to run on sharded MySQL. The goal was to solve the problems highlighted in the previous section. TAO stands for “The MySQL is the primary database used by Facebook for storing all the social data.

While a NoSQL database can provide massive scalability, it does not guarantee data consistency. Intermittent problems from inconsistent data can place a burden on the development team. Developers must construct safeguards into their microservice code to manage problems caused by inconsistent data.
Ppap

Does facebook use nosql mc med tre hjul
managing director wiki
historie filmu
lasa tankar
johnny bode vad ska en stackars fattig flicka göra_

2 Oct 2019 NoSQL Excursions in Relational SQL Databases NoSQL. There are many reasons why someone would want to use the comfort of a relational database. Unless you are building a new, Facebook-like application, chances .

So, FB used its significant engineering might to essentially create a custom database query layer that abstracted the underlying sharded MySQL databases. In doing so, it forced its developers to If you need a quick answer here it is: MySQL is the primary database used by Facebook for storing all the social data. It started with the InnoDB MySQL database engine & then wrote MyRocksDB, which was eventually used as the MySQL Database engine. Memcache sits in front of MySQL as a cache.


Farmacia uppsala
låsbar box kylskåp

2011-01-02

Of the well known public NoSQL solutions: HBase is used for messages and monitoring Hadoop /hive is the primary big data analytical store In early 2009, FB started building TAO, a FB-specific NoSQL graph API built to run on sharded MySQL. The goal was to solve the problems highlighted in the previous section. TAO stands for “The MySQL is the primary database used by Facebook for storing all the social data. It started with the InnoDB MySQL database engine & then wrote MyRocksDB, which was eventually used as the MySQL Database engine. Memcache sits in front of MySQL as a cache.

18 Dec 2013 NoSQL and NewSQL data stores present themselves as alternatives Just on Facebook, 2.4 billion content items are shared among friends 

It started with the InnoDB MySQL database engine & then wrote MyRocksDB, which was eventually used as the MySQL Database engine.

The following features are driving the popularity of NoSQL databases like MongoDB, CouchDB, Cassandra, and HBase: 1. 2018-03-05 · Nor does it enforce relations between tables in all cases. All its documents are JSON documents, which are complete entities that one can readily read and understand.